Narrative Opinion Summary
The Court of Appeals for the Eighth District of Texas grants Genesis Stephens an extension to file the Reporter’s Record until February 7, 2020, in the case of Jesus Alberto Mireles, Appellant, against the State of Texas. The Court specifies that no further requests for extension will be considered. Genesis Stephens, the Official Court Reporter for the 384th District Court of El Paso County, is ordered to prepare and submit the Reporter’s Record by the specified deadline. This order was issued on January 9, 2020, and signed by the panel including Chief Justice Alley and Justices Rodriguez and Palafox.
